Patricia Medina

Patricia Medina is an associate in the Labour and Human Resources department of Osterling Abogados. She specialises in labour, social security and immigration law. She also has significant experience in occupational health and safety.

She provides preventive and corrective advice on labour and human resources matters to a large portfolio of national and foreign companies in the mining, industrial, fishing, technology, health and marketing sectors, among others.

Patricia’s practice includes the design and implementation of hiring policies (direct and indirect), remuneration, compensation, benefits and terminations (individual and collective), as well as the handling of judicial and administrative labour matters.

In the field of occupational health and safety, she has successfully intervened in the implementation of the Occupational Health and Safety Management System – OHSMS in several companies, as well as in the execution of preventive audits that guarantee compliance with the regulations in force on the subject.
Patricia also has a sound knowledge of the rules governing the international recruitment and posting of workers. Her advice in this area includes the procedures for obtaining work visas and residence permits for expatriate staff.

She speaks Spanish and English.
